There are many more features within the Pathagoras suite that
are not discussed in previous sections. Here is a short list of some
not yet mentioned.
- GotForms? This is similar to the
Instant Database module describe under a separate tab. It identifies
[bracketed variables] and allow you to replace each variable with its
appropriate personal value. However, it operates one variable at a time
(as opposed to all variables at a time in the IDB module) and does not
have a 'save to a database' feature. It is intended to work with quick,
down and dirty forms completion where there is no need to save the
information for reuse.

SmartNotes. You can attach a 'usage' note to every clause to
let a user know how and when a particular clause should be used within a
document.
-
Conversion tools. Easily convert folders of clauses
to glossaries, and vice versa. This makes it easy to 'test' which kind
of book works best in your particular office environment.

*Star variables* Pathagoras allows you to maintain
very long lists of multiple choice variables within what we call *star
variables*. These are easy to create lists which might represent
the 50 United States or all of the countries on Earth. You reference
them within a source document simply as (for example) "[*states*]". When
the IDB module is activated, you are presented a list of all 50 states
from which to choose.
-
"Tree Service." Available in several of the
Pathagoras modules, the optional 'Tree Service' tells Pathagoras to
display not only the documents within the target folder, but the
sub-folders beneath it. This allows you instant access to hundreds,
perhaps thousands, of documents without ever having to return to the
Windows Explorer (the 'file opening screen').
-
Clause-sets. When assembling documents of let's say
12 sections, 10 of which are almost always the same, and only 2 might
vary, it gets frustrating to repetitively select the same base
paragraphs time after time. But on the other hand, you don't want to use
a complete document as source text. Why? Because if a clause in a
'complete' document needs to change, and that same clause appears in 20
other 'complete documents,' you must open all 20 to effect the change.
Clause-sets is the solution. A clause set is in the nature of a complete
document, but it is 'composed' of references to text, not the actual
text. When document assembly is requested, Pathagoras assembles the
referenced clauses. That way, if the substance of a particular clause
changes, only the source clause need be changed. And the next time a
clause set which contains a reference to the source is called, the
freshest text will be inserted.
-
Synchronize: Pathagoras allows you to store
your source documents anywhere. On your 'C:\ drive, on any network
drive, across the world on your wide area network, on an 'ftp://'
server. And you can assemble with a direct connection to those files.
But sometimes your connection to the file server is not available. A
broken connection, no landline or wireless access. Or sometimes the
connection is there, but the speed is lacking. Pathagoras allows you to
synchronize you local computer (whether desktop or laptop) to the file
server in the morning to make sure that you have the latest versions,
and then you are no longer dependent upon the remote connection.
